Output 5a871398644df005f24a29659cc7bc4d53d314c6c868c1f8e489e093d24a1542:1

value
11500000
script pubkey
OP_0 OP_PUSHBYTES_20 ddf4e07cd0d251f8f0b8033f2540f3fae56516b3
address
bc1qmh6wqlxs6fgl3u9cqvlj2s8nltjk294n32zuwa
transaction
5a871398644df005f24a29659cc7bc4d53d314c6c868c1f8e489e093d24a1542
spent
true